Sunday 7th June, 2009
Tremendous congratulations go to the five Boys from The 79th Glasgow Boys’ Brigade Company who were recently awarded with their Queen’s Badge award.
Craig Barbour, Donald Lundie, Jonathan McKinney, Greig Cunningham and Scott Sutherland were all presented with their award on Friday 29th May by Football players’ chief Fraser Wishart. The awards were presented at the annual Company Section Display, which featured the undefeated drill squad, vaulting squad and various games and sketches.
Robbie Sutherland, Company Captain also presented a cheque to the value of £250 to Julie Robertson, local co-ordinator of the Guide Dogs for the Blind charity.
Congratulations to everyone who helped raise this money, to all the Boys for their work and achievements throughout the year, and especially to the Company’s newest Queen’s Men.
